我用PHP编写非常简单的电子邮件客户端应用程序。在我的本地开发服务器上一切正常,但是当我在生产服务器上移动相同的脚本时,我得到“无法连接到secure.emailsrvr.com,993:连接超时”响应。我尝试了几乎所有的东西,搜索谷歌两天,但没有找到解决方案!
两台服务器都具有确切的配置,因此没有问题! phpinfo()完全相同(启用了imap,ssl,...包含所有扩展,服务器日志没有错误)
用户名,密码和服务器数据相同且100%正确(如果我更改凭据或服务器数据,我得到正确的错误而不是超时)。服务器支持人员向我保证IP没有被阻止。
我使用的非常简单的连接脚本(这里是它被卡住的地方)。端口是正确的,也是主机!
$mbox=imap_open("{imap.emailsrvr.com:993/imap/ssl}INBOX", "my_user", "my_pass");
有人有过类似的问题吗?
此致 Jernej Gololicic
答案 0 :(得分:0)
如果您的操作系统不同,那么您最有可能安装了不同的IMAP扩展程序。